Flowchart For Structured Programming
8 flowchart techniques for structured programming.
Flowchart for structured programming. Break the procedure into its basic blocks. It makes use of symbols which are connected among them to indicate the flow of information and processing. It was originated from computer science as a tool for representing algorithms and programming logic but had extended to use in all other kinds of processes. 2 google scholar digital library.
With the advent of structured programming and goto less programming a method is needed to model computation in simply ordered structures. Here are some of the ways flowcharts are used today. Run rfflow and click on tools number shapes and put a check mark in enable numbers for the entire chart. You can type a simple list using your word processor.
As a graduate student i got the idea while attending an acm organized talk in new york by michael jackson on structured programming. Structured flowchart can be translated into a structured program is pleasantly surprising. Program or system design through flowchart programming. Application to cobol identify the basic blocks in the procedure.
A flowchart is a type of diagram that represents a workflow or process a flowchart can also be defined as a diagrammatic representation of an algorithm a step by step approach to solving a task. The fascinating history and evolution of structured flowcharts usually called nassi shneiderman diagrams or structograms goes back to 1972. Flowchart is a graphical representation of an algorithm. We believe that the control structures descri bed above are sufficient to get the flavor of the model.
Today flowcharts are used for a variety of purposes in manufacturing architecture engineering business technology education science medicine government administration and many other disciplines. A flowchart is a graphical representations of steps. A flowchart can be helpful for both writing programs and explaining the program to others. Nowadays flowcharts play an extremely important role in displaying information and assisting reasoning.
The power of a flowchart becomes evident when you include decisions and loops. The contour model of block structured processes by john b. Rfflow allows you to number your shapes if you wish. The process of drawing a flowchart for an algorithm is known as flowcharting.
Flowchart in programming a flowchart is a diagrammatic representation of an algorithm. Johnston sigplan notices v 6 no. Programmers often use it as a program planning tool to solve a problem.